Several held in Mohmand search operation
GHALLANAI: The law-enforcers on Saturday arrested several suspected persons and recovered arms from them during a joint search operation in Mohmand Agency, official sources said.
They said the operation was carried out against the militants, their facilitators and abettors who fled the settled areas and other parts of the tribal region due to actions against them and were hiding in the areas along the boundary with Charsadda district.
They said the personnel of the security forces, police, Frontier Corps, Levies and Khassadar forces took part in the search operation carried out in parts of Pandyalai tehsil of Mohmand Agency and Charsadda district.
They said the law-enforces had cordoned off the area and searched suspicious places and houses in the operation which was started early in the morning and continued till 4pm in the evening.
The forces claimed success in the operation and said several suspected persons had been arrested while huge quantity of arms was seized in the operation. They said more targetted operations would be carried out in the area.
